Category: None Group: None Status: Open Resolution: None Priority: 5 Submitted By: Jeremy Enos (jenos) Assigned to: Nobody/Anonymous (nobody) Summary: /proc/.* excludes Initial Comment: On Redhat 9 machines, I've noticed that certain daemons create hidden subdirectories in /proc/ after the host is up for some time. I don't know what creates them or what their purpose is, but I do know that they're purged on a reboot, and that they will make rsync error out w/ code 23 (main.c). I think it has something to do w/ a bad symlink or something.
